mruby master changes

mruby masterの変更履歴

2014-06-01から1ヶ月間の記事一覧

mruby master changes bdbc1f0

2014-06-29 09:52 ksss commit bdbc1f0 mrbgems/mruby-objectspace/src/mruby_objectspace.cでswitch文で操作されていない22個の列挙型についてdefaultで処理し、ワーニングを減らしています

mruby master changes 73c086b - 9726dbe

2014-06-26 22:22 SHyx0rmZ commit 73c086b 小さな最適化を犠牲にして、重複しているコードを削除しています 2014-06-27 22:10 matz commit 4ce0a76 例外の割り当てでmrb_funcall()関数の呼び出しを減らしています 2014-06-27 22:39 matz commit 919af61 Rub…

mruby master changes 2adb411 - 09d8cd6

2014-06-26 21:08 take_cheeze commit 2adb411 mrbconfsの残りドキュメントを記載しています 2014-06-26 21:09 take_cheeze commit d7d0c31 デフォルト値を引用符で囲っています 2014-06-26 21:47 suzukaze commit 09d8cd6 doc/api/mruby.h.mdの誤字を修正し…

mruby master changs ac0addd - 3402798

2014-06-18 15:49 matz commit ac0addd mrb_open_core()関数をリファクタリングして、ローカル変数を減らしています 2014-06-23 21:24 take_cheeze commit ae15f26 C APIsのドキュメントを始めました 2014-06-23 22:12 take_cheeze commit 6336dbb メモリー…

mruby maste changes 0a6b54a - baca365

順序 コミットの日付が時系列順ではないように見えますが、プルリクが採用された順番になっています 2014-06-20 21:49 take_cheeze commit 0a6b54a Symbolの拡張クラスで capitalize, downcase, upcaseメソッドの新しい文字列の生成を減らしています。未修正…

mruby master changes 1cced27 - 907a299

2014-06-15 22:34 ksss commit 1cced27 src/class.cで最初のメソッド定義の前にProcクラスを定義しています 2014-06-15 22:38 ksss commit 907a299 src/proc.cでmrb_proc_arity()はcfunc用はまだ実装されていない-1を返すようにしています。 mrb_proc_arity(…

mruby master changes 5355a4a - e43341b

2014-06-22 04:05 suzukaze commit 5355a4a doc/mrbconf/README.mdのドキュメントを修正しています 2014-06-22 12:52 suzukaze commit d1d8bcb doc/mrbgems/README.mdのドキュメントを修正しています 2014-06-22 13:11 suzukaze commit e43341b doc/compile/…

mruby master changes 45e04c9 - 18c6950

2014-06-21 18:24 matz commit 45e04c9 mrb_context_run()の初めての実行のためにローカル変数をクリアしています。参照:#2405 2014-06-21 22:00 take_cheeze commit 18c6950 ドキュメント中のRubyコードをgithub flavored markdownでシンタックスハイライト…

mruby master changes 94ae70e - dd37c52

2014-06-19 21:27 take_cheeze commit 94ae70e mrbconfの使用方法に関する注意事項を追加しています 2014-06-19 21:39 take_cheeze commit 412c86b プリミティブ型の設定ドキュメントを追加しています 2014-06-19 22:02 take_cheeze commit dd37c52 mrbconfs…

mruby master changes eab4a74 - ec04fa7

2014-06-15 21:21 suzukaze commit eab4a74 src/string.cのmrb_str_aref_m()でRegexがサポートされていないので、ドキュメントから削除しています 2014-06-18 15:54 matz commit 42f5b74 mruby (コア)に存在しないクラスのためのsuperclassテストを削除して…

mruby master changes 0ae199c

2014-06-17 22:46 take_cheeze commit 0ae199c mrbconfのドキュメントを追加しています

mruby master changes 62f41dd - 17e3203

2014-06-16 16:03 take_cheeze commit 62f41dd fixed state atexit stack機能を追加しています。次のマクロを追加しています MRB_FIXED_STATE_ATEXIT_STACK (デフォルトでは定義されていない) 定義されるとfixed state atexit stackが有効になります MRB_FIX…

mruby master changes 00fa809

2014-06-11 00:36 suzukaze commit 00fa809 String#slice!を実装しています

mruby master changes 2ed7089 - 61032c5

2014-06-13 00:41 matz commit 2ed7089 Hashのキーにライトバリアを呼ぶようにしています。参照: #2375 2014-06-13 01:07 take_cheeze commit eebb944 add_conflictを実装しています。利用方法はadd_dependencyに似ています 2014-06-13 12:50 matz commit 8e…

mruby master changes 6157e50

2014-06-12 13:57 take_cheeze commit 6157e50 add_conflictsを実装してます。 #2383を解決しています

mruby master changes 75d1412 - f1e15b0

2014-06-11 23:09 suzukaze commit 75d1412 RSTR_NOFREE_Pマクロの使用方法をリファクタリングしています 2014-06-11 14:42 ksss commit bd53818 String#replaceのメモリリークを修正してます 2014-06-11 14:46 ksss commit f1e15b0 String#clearをString#re…

mruby master changes 9c259c5

2014-06-11 01:00 suzukaze commit 9c259c5 MRB_STR_NOFREEフラグを操作するNOFREEマクロを追加しています

mruby master changes c6d589e - fe95f44

2014-06-09 23:08 monaka commit c6d589e コアビルドにinclude/ dirsをエクスポートしないようにしています 現状の振る舞いでは、mrbgemsのinclude/ dirsはコアのコンパイラーに設定されています。それらは、mrbgemsのinclude_pathsはけして設定されません …

mruby master changes d386b35 - 4f3114d

2014-06-09 16:34 take_cheeze commit d386b35 Time.atの引数の仕様を修正しています 2014-06-09 18:47 take_cheeze commit 4de468e 汚いトリックの代わりにmrb_assertに戻しています 2014-06-09 23:00 kou commit 4f3114d 「,」のあとに空白を追加しています

mruby master changes 32e4501 - 78176ee

2014-06-07 22:16 matz commit 32e4501 STR_*マクロの名前を変更しつつ、 mruby/string.hに移動しています 2014-06-07 22:23 matz commit 76012a8 mruby-string-extのテストコードからUTF-8文字列を削除しています 2014-06-07 22:28 matz commit 6459a98 Str…

mruby master changes 9709fe7 - b0c9014

2014-06-05 01:10 suzukaze commit 9709fe7 String#clearを実装しています 2014-06-07 16:51 matz commit 20dc629 str_discard()をインラインにしています。参照:#2370 2014-06-07 17:24 matz commit b0c9014 sharedとnofreeフラグをクリアしています。参照:…

mruby master changes b1dd57e - 39bbdd5

2014-06-06 00:19 matz commit b1dd57e プライベートにすべきIS_EVSTRマクロを ヘッダからsrc/string.cに移動しています 2014-06-06 00:54 take_cheeze commit 4c1fb65 mrb_closeで mrb->atexit_stackを解放するようにしています 2014-06-05 18:30 cremno co…

mruby master changes 1720608 - cc28f86

2014-06-04 18:57 matz commit 1720608 Hash#to_hを追加しています。参照: #2348 2014-06-04 22:53 take_cheeze commit fb3c2f6 Cコードが修正されたのはときに、Cコードを再生成するように、依存関係の生成スクリプトを追加します。 2014-06-04 23:37 matz …

mruby master changes c927277 - 84e1b0a

2014-06-03 19:48 suzukaze commit e67817f String#chrを実装しています 2014-06-03 20:20 mattn commit ab0b1c4 utf-8用にString#chrを実装しています 2014-06-03 20:33 mattn commit 1fab966 utf-8用にString#chrのテストコードを追加しています 2014-06-0…

mruby master changes b81f0d0 - 4380f86

2014-06-02 22:00 suzukaze commit b81f0d0 String#lstrip, rstrip, strip, lstring!, rstrip!およびstrip!のメソッドのコメントを追加しています 2014-06-03 10:55 tsahara-iij commit fe9f3fd String#%を実装しています 2014-06-03 16:33 matz commit 4380…

mruby master changes de8916b

2014-06-01 09:51 cremno commit de8916b mgemテスト引数の受け渡しを修正しています

mruby master changes 35d4137 - 15ab1b7

2014-06-01 02:51 matz commit 35d4137 意図がわからないので9cd71916のテストコードを削除しています 2014-06-01 22:04 yui-knk commit e413294 空白を削除しています 2014-06-01 22:07 yui-knk commit 15ab1b7 インデント修正しています

mruby master changes c131f69 - 36ab17d

2014-05-31 14:10 yui-knk commit c131f69 空白を削除しています 2014-05-31 10:23 katmutua commit 36ab17d src/gc.cでの誤字を修正しています